Abstract

An increased risk of morbidity and mortality is associated with acute pancreatitis (AP) brought on by hypertriglyceridemia (HTG). It is essential to locate the root cause as soon as possible and give those affected the attention they need. The treatment plan includes efforts to lower blood triglyceride levels and supportive care. HTG-induced AP has a similar clinical course to people with other types of acute pancreatitis. However, HTG-induced AP patients have significantly higher clinical severity and associated consequences. As a result, therapy and preventing sickness recurrence depend on a correct diagnosis. At the moment, there are no acknowledged standards for the treatment of HTG-induced AP. Some therapy approaches that effectively decrease serum triglycerides include fibric acids, apheresis/plasmapheresis, insulin, heparin, and omega-3 fatty acids. Following acute phase care, lifestyle modifications, including dietary and drug therapy, are essential for long-term HTG-induced AP control and relapse prevention. To create complete and efficient HTG-induced AP treatment guidelines, more study is required.

Antibiotic Use in Diabetes Mellitus Patients with Gangrene at Abdoel Wahab Sjahranie Samarinda Hospital
Sciences of Pharmacy Volume 1
Publisher : PT. ETFLIN Scientific Society

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Gangrene is one of the complications of diabetes mellitus. Along with the rising prevalence of diabetes mellitus (DM), the prevalence of gangrene and necrosis manifestations such as ulcers and infections will ascend. The selection of appropriate antibiotics is critical in infection therapy. Inappropriate use of antibiotics will result in antibiotic resistance. Therefore, this research aims to overview demographic, clinical characteristics, antibiotic use profiles, and antibiotic-related problems for DM patients with gangrene at the Abdoel Wahab Sjahranie Samarinda Hospital. The study was retrospective research and was conducted in July-December 2021. Twenty-one patients met the inclusion criteria, and demographic data showed that most patients were men 57% (n=11), and most age was 39-59 years (57%, n=12). The longest period of suffering from gangrene was 6-10 years (14%, n=3). The most common length of hospitalization was 8-14 days, as reported by 52 percent (n=11) of patients, and the most common duration of antibiotic use was ten days, as reported by 86 percent (n=18) of patients. A single-used antibiotic was ceftriaxone (19%, n=4) patients. The most used antibiotic combination was ceftriaxone and metronidazole (81%, n=17). Fourteen patients used antibiotics appropriately in dosage, route, and frequency. Four patients were unsuitable for the benefit of antibiotics in terms of antibiotic type, and three patients were unsuitable for antibiotic use in terms of duration of administration.
Knowledge Level of OTC and OTC Limited Drugs Use for Self-medication in the Community of Tondo Village, Mantikulore District, Central Sulawesi, Indonesia
Sciences of Pharmacy Volume 1
Publisher : PT. ETFLIN Scientific Society

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Self-medication is treatment without a doctor's prescription, based on the 2022 BPS, the percentage of self-medication for the people of Central Sulawesi in 2021 is 85.85%. The purpose of the study was to determine the characteristics of the community who did self-medication, minor illnesses that were treated with self-medication, the profile of over-the-counter (OTC) and OTC limited medicines for self-medication and the level of knowledge of these medicines use for self-medication in the community of Tondo Village. This type of research was descriptive with a sample of 386 respondents who were taken using purposive sampling. Time of data collection during August – November 2021. Based on the results, the respondents characteristics were female (52.3%) aged 26-35 (24.4%), household work (31.1%), history of high school education (46.4%). Minor illnesses that were treated using self-medication were fever (15.54%), ulcer (7.46%), cough (15.54%), flu (18.91%), diarrhea (2.85%), headache (1 .30%), and allergy (0.78%). The profiles of OTC and OTC limited drugs are limited to paracetamol for fever (33.16%), antacids for ulcers (75.70%), Komix® for coughs (28.8%), Mixagrib® for flu (36.99%), Entrostop® for diarrhea (70,00%), Ibuprofen for headaches (100%), and CTM for allergies (100%). Number of pharmacy or drug store was 61.46%. The selection of drugs were based on experience and personal/family usage history (84.46%), and the reason for self-medication was to save treatment costs (47.15%). The level of knowledge on the use of OTC and OTC limited drugs was categorized as good (75.09%). Based on the findings, we can conclude that the level of knowledge on the use of OTC and OTC limited drugs for self-medication of Tondo people is categorized as good.

In-silico design and screening of cephalosporin derivatives for their inhibitory potential against Haemophilus influenza
Sciences of Phytochemistry Volume 1
Publisher : PT. ETFLIN Scientific Society

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Antibiotics kill bacteria by blocking essential metabolic processes which prevent them from reproducing thereby allowing the immune system to fight bacterial infections. However, the emergence and the quick spread of bacterial resistance against clinically approved antibiotics have become alarming. This necessitates the development of novel treatment options and alternative antimicrobial therapies in the fight against bacterial infections. In this study, we aim to virtually design and carry out in-silico studies to identify a cephalosporin derivative with inhibitory potential against Haemophilus influenza. Data Warrior software, Discovery studio software, PyRx tool, Swiss ADME web tool, and ProTox-II web tool were used to screen the cephalosporin derivatives. Initially, 17 cephalosporin derivatives were preliminarily screened for their toxicity followed by in-silico ADME studies. Among the cephalosporin derivatives, C1, C6, and C12 were found to be the potential drug-like molecules with binding energies of -7.4 kcal/mol, -7.1 kcal/mol, and -7.1 kcal/mol, respectively. In particular, C1 was predicted to have a moderate biological activity with a high bioavailability score. Based on the ADME profile, toxicity, binding energy, drug-likeness, and drug score, we conclude C1 (‘F’ at the 3rd position) as the potential lead molecule to inhibit H. influenza.
